    Cambodian journalist, photographer, and activist Dith Pran was a Cambodian journalist who suffered four years of abusive treatment after the Communist Khmer Rouge forces took over his country in 1975. Pran eventually escaped and became a crusader for justice in Cambodia. His story was portrayed in the 1984 movie The Killing Fields. Early years

    NEW BRUNSWICK, NJ (March 30, 2008) – Dith Pran, the Cambodian photojournalist who survived starvation, torture, and the Khmer Rouge reign of genocide, and whose story was the basis of the 1984 Academy Award-winning movie "The Killing Fields," this morning lost his valiant battle with pancreatic cancer.
